Gliocladiopsis
1954Summary
Gliocladiopsis is a fungi genus in the Nectriaceae family. It contains 19 species, including Gliocladiopsis aquaticus, Gliocladiopsis curvata, and Gliocladiopsis ecuadoriensis.
